9 ® BreadCrumb JR USER GUIDE PRELIMINARY Version: 1.00-pre1 Date: May 6, 2010 Corporate Headquarters Rajant Corporation 400 East King Street Malvern, PA 19355 Tel: (484) 595-0233 Fax: (484) 595-0244 http://www.rajant.
FCC and IC Statements This equipment has been tested and found to comply with the limits for a Class A digital device, pursuant to Part 15 of the FCC Rules. These limits are designed to provide reasonable protection against harmful interference when the device is operated in a commercial environment. This device generates, uses, and can radiate radio frequency energy and, if not installed and used in accordance with this instruction manual, may cause harmful interference to radio communications.
Rajant Corporation 20-100035-001 BreadCrumb® JR User Guide - PRELIMINARY Version: 1.00-pre1 Table of Contents FCC and IC Statements.................................................................................................... Copyright Statement......................................................................................................... Preface....................................................................................................................................
BreadCrumb® JR User Guide - PRELIMINARY Version: 1.00-pre1 Rajant Corporation 20-100035-001 3.4.1 Deployment Guidelines......................................................................................15 3.4.2 Deployment Methodology...................................................................................16 4 BreadCrumb JR OTA Firmware Upgrade......................................................................19 5 Troubleshooting..............................................................
BreadCrumb® JR User Guide - PRELIMINARY Version: 1.00-pre1 Rajant Corporation 20-100035-001 Preface Purpose and Scope This manual provides information and guidance to all personnel who are involved with and use Rajant Corporation’s BreadCrumb JR product. This manual begins with an introduction to the BreadCrumb Wireless Network (BCWN). It then characterizes the features of the BreadCrumb JR. Finally, it describes common deployment scenarios and provides concise step-by-step instructions for each scenario.
BreadCrumb® JR User Guide - PRELIMINARY Version: 1.00-pre1 Rajant Corporation 20-100035-001 1 Introduction Rajant Corporation's (http://www.rajant.com) BreadCrumb JR utilizes the 802.11g wireless networking standard to form a wireless mesh network. The network is mobile, self-integrating, selfmeshing, self-healing, full-duplex and secure. The focus is on flexibility, adaptability, and simplicity.
BreadCrumb® JR User Guide - PRELIMINARY Version: 1.00-pre1 Rajant Corporation 20-100035-001 In many cases, BreadCrumbs will perform all of these tasks as shipped with no configuration necessary at all, providing an instant TAN (Tactical Area Network). Moreover, because BreadCrumbs use industry-standard 802.11 communications, client devices such as laptops or handheld computers require no special hardware, software, or configuration to access a BCWN.
BreadCrumb® JR User Guide - PRELIMINARY Version: 1.00-pre1 Rajant Corporation 20-100035-001 BREADCRUMB A BREADCRUMB C RADIO 1 RADIO 2 CH AN NE L 11 CHANNEL 1 CHANNEL 8 RADIO 1 RADIO 2 RADIO 1 RADIO 2 BREADCRUMB B Figure 1: All BreadCrumbs Use the Same ESSID. Example 2: Now suppose that you change the ESSID of BreadCrumb C to "lonely".
BreadCrumb® JR User Guide - PRELIMINARY Version: 1.00-pre1 Rajant Corporation 20-100035-001 The radio supports the following channels and frequencies in the United States and Canada (see Table 1): Note Not all channels are allowed for use everywhere around the world. Check with the corresponding wireless spectrum regulatory body to determine the subset of channels authorized for use in your country. Table 1: 2.4 GHz Radio Channels and Frequencies.
BreadCrumb® JR User Guide - PRELIMINARY Version: 1.00-pre1 Rajant Corporation 20-100035-001 Figure 3: BreadCrumb JR Enclosure Features 1.2.3 Antenna Connector BreadCrumb JR provides one Type N antenna connector located on the top of the enclosure (see Figure 3). Warning 1.2.4 To avoid possible damage to the BreadCrumb radio, always connect or disconnect the external antenna with the power to the BreadCrumb JR off.
BreadCrumb® JR User Guide - PRELIMINARY Version: 1.00-pre1 Rajant Corporation 20-100035-001 Figure 4: 10-Pin Amphenol Connector The 10-pin Amphenol connector interfaces with the optional JR cable assemblies which provide access to input power, Ethernet, GPS data, and 3.3 V output power (see section 1.3). 1.2.4.1 Input Power The input power interface to BreadCrumb JR resides on the F (VIN) and K (GND) pins of the 10-pin Amphenol connector (see Figure 4). The device accepts input power in the range of 10.
BreadCrumb® JR User Guide - PRELIMINARY Version: 1.00-pre1 Rajant Corporation 20-100035-001 1.2.4.3 GPS Data Interface The BreadCrumb JR contains a serial GPS data interface which can be accessed through the A (GPS TXD) and B (GPS RXD) pins of the 10-pin Amphenol connector (see Figure 4). 1.2.4.4 3.3 V Output Power Pin G (3.3V) on the 10-pin Amphenol connector provides 3.3 V output power at 0.5 A (see Figure 4). 1.2.4.
BreadCrumb® JR User Guide - PRELIMINARY Version: 1.00-pre1 Warning 1.2.6 Rajant Corporation 20-100035-001 Unlike other BreadCrumb models, the Status LEDs on the BreadCrumb JR are always ON. There is not an “Alerts Only” or “OFF” Mode available. The LEDs must be physically masked (such as adding tape to the LED panel) to guarantee that no light is emitted at any time.
BreadCrumb® JR User Guide - PRELIMINARY Version: 1.00-pre1 Rajant Corporation 20-100035-001 Note 1.3.1 The two currently existing optional cable assemblies do not provide access to the GPIO interface of the BreadCrumb JR. 4-Pin GPS Connector The GPS connector, a Switchcraft EN3L4MX connector (see Figure 7) is designed to interface with an optional GPS device available from Rajant.
BreadCrumb® JR User Guide - PRELIMINARY Version: 1.00-pre1 Rajant Corporation 20-100035-001 2 Using BC|Commander BC|Commander is Rajant’s software package used for monitoring the status of BreadCrumbs with version 10 firmware on a BreadCrumb Wireless Network (BCWN). BC|Commander is also used for configuring version 10 BreadCrumbs and to graphically portray the network topology. Note BC|Commander includes an option called v10 Transitional Mode.
BreadCrumb® JR User Guide - PRELIMINARY Version: 1.00-pre1 Rajant Corporation 20-100035-001 3 Deploying the BreadCrumb Wireless Network There are many factors which need to be taken into account when deploying the BreadCrumb Wireless Network (BCWN). Section 3.1 describes the addressing scheme of the BCWN. Section 3.2 discusses channel assignments. Section 3.3 details some of the most commonly occurring environmental factors that will have a major impact on the performance of the BCWN.
BreadCrumb® JR User Guide - PRELIMINARY Version: 1.00-pre1 3.3 Rajant Corporation 20-100035-001 Physical Placement and other Considerations Commonly occurring environmental factors have a significant impact on performance and behavior of the BreadCrumb Wireless Network. LOS (Line of Sight) obstructions, distance, weather, and device placement should all be considered when deploying a wireless network. IEEE 802.
BreadCrumb® JR User Guide - PRELIMINARY Version: 1.00-pre1 Rajant Corporation 20-100035-001 3.3.3 Weather Precipitation and fog also act as obstructions blocking the propagation of the wireless network’s radio waves. Light fog or precipitation may result in noticeable degradation of wireless network performance. Heavy precipitation or fog may result in severe performance degradation and possible loss of network connectivity.
BreadCrumb® JR User Guide - PRELIMINARY Version: 1.00-pre1 Rajant Corporation 20-100035-001 (a) Elevate the BCWN components whenever possible. i. Directly on the ground, the maximum distance between any two BCWN components is approximately 300 ft. Also, the maximum distance between a wireless client and the nearest BCWN component is approximately 300 ft. ii. Rajant recommends elevating each BCWN component a minimum of 6 ft. above the surrounding terrain for maximum range.
Rajant Corporation 20-100035-001 BreadCrumb® JR User Guide - PRELIMINARY Version: 1.00-pre1 4. Power ON the device. 5. Wait approximately 90 seconds for the device to boot. 6. Power ON the BC|Commander PC. 7. Start BC|Commander. 8. The BC|Commander console should display the first BreadCrumb. 9. Determine the approximate location for the next BreadCrumb. 10.Proceed to the location for this BreadCrumb, observing the network in BC|Commander as you progress.
BreadCrumb® JR User Guide - PRELIMINARY Version: 1.00-pre1 Rajant Corporation 20-100035-001 4 BreadCrumb JR OTA Firmware Upgrade Each BreadCrumb relies on low-level software known as firmware for proper execution. Rajant periodically releases updated BreadCrumb firmware. The updated firmware must be obtained from Rajant.
BreadCrumb® JR User Guide - PRELIMINARY Version: 1.00-pre1 Rajant Corporation 20-100035-001 5 5.1 Troubleshooting Sporadic Network Connectivity Table 3: Sporadic Network Connectivity Issues. Problem Resolution As a BreadCrumb device’s battery approaches exhaustion, network connectivity will become sporadic for the BreadCrumb device and its associated wireless clients. Monitory battery usage and charge/replace batteries as necessary.
BreadCrumb® JR User Guide - PRELIMINARY Version: 1.00-pre1 Rajant Corporation 20-100035-001 Problem Resolution using the software accompanying your wireless card. 5.2 • Ensure that the wireless client’s IP address settings are configured properly. • Ensure that the security settings on the client device and BreadCrumb devices match. • Ensure that the client device is not prevented from connecting by an ACL.
Rajant Corporation 20-100035-001 BreadCrumb® ME3 User Guide Version: 1.00-pre1 Appendix A: Error and Warning Codes All possible BreadCrumb error and warning codes are listed below: JR/LX/LX3/ME3 Firmware Upgrade Codes (1*). 11 – Flash image file does not exist. 12 – Current flash image version is greater than versions of files found on USB drive. 13 – No flash image files found. 14 – Unable to mount USB drive. 15 – Unlocking of /dev/mtd0 failed. 16 – fconfig for SetFailsafeBoot failed.
BreadCrumb® ME3 User Guide Version: 1.00-pre1 Rajant Corporation 20-100035-001 128 – Failed to checksum file system image. 129 – Failed to create directory for next file system image. 131 – Failed to mount next file system image. 132 – Failed to create directory for settings. 133 – Failed to copy current settings to next file system image. 134 – Failed to unmount next file system image. 141 – Error retrieving flash file. ME2 Firmware Upgrade Codes (2*) 21 – Flash image file does not exist.
Rajant Corporation 20-100035-001 BreadCrumb® ME3 User Guide Version: 1.00-pre1 FIPS Codes (4*) 41 – FIPS self-tests failed. 411 – OpenSSL FIPS vector test programs not found. 412 – OpenSSL FIPS vector test hash mismatch. 413 – 802.11i AES-CCMP test vectors failed. 414 – Unable to use FIPS CCMP encryption. 415 – Kernel integrity check failed. 416 – Filesystem integrity check failed. 42 – Mixed SecNet/Non-SecNet configuration. 43 – Rekeying error. 44 – Rekeying error. 45 – Rekeying error.
BreadCrumb® ME3 User Guide Version: 1.00-pre1 Battery Gas Gauge Codes (6*) 61 – Battery gas gauge i2c device could not be found. 62 – Incorrect gas gauge revision 1 EEPROM settings. 63 – Incorrect gas gauge revision 2 EEPROM settings. 64 – Incorrect gas gauge revision 3 EEPROM settings. 65 – Unknown gas gauge revision. 66 – Incorrect ME3 gas gauge revision 0 EEPROM settings. Other Codes (7*) 71 – Host flapping detected. 72 – Critical I2C failure.